THERMAL INSULATING SURFACE STRUCTURE OF CUSHION FOR AUTOMOBILE AND MOTORCYCLE
20220267581 · 2022-08-25 ·

A thermal insulating surface structure of a cushion for automobiles and motorcycles is provided. The thermal insulating surface structure includes a main body layer. The main body layer is formed from a polyvinyl chloride resin composition. The polyvinyl chloride resin composition includes polyvinyl chloride and a metal complex. Based on a total weight of the polyvinyl chloride resin composition being 100 wt %, an amount of the metal complex ranges from 3 wt % to 20 wt %.

FLUID FILLABLE SEAT CUSHION
20210161305 · 2021-06-03 ·

A fluid fillable cushioning device comprises an enclosure comprising a top wall and a bottom wall, a cavity defined by the enclosure, a threaded inlet in the enclosure connected to the cavity, the cavity further defined by the threaded inlet, and a fastening mechanism extending from the enclosure, the fastening mechanism configured to fasten the cushioning device to a seat. In operation, fluid, such as water, is filled in the cavity of the cushioning device, and in some cases foam is also included in the cavity, providing a water and/or foam cushion for a user sitting on the cushioning device. When used on seat of a bicycle, where the user's body interacts with the cushioning device with significant pressure for extended period of time, the cushioning device provides customizable cushioning which feels like an extension of the body, and is exceptionally comfortable.

CONTROLLED DEFORMATION BICYCLE SADDLE
20210129931 · 2021-05-06 ·

A bicycle saddle includes a shell fitted with fastening means for fastening the bicycle saddle to an associable bicycle, the shell extending, in a prevailing longitudinal direction (Y-Y), from a front end to a rear end, and a padding associated to an upper portion of the shell, opposite a frame of the associable bicycle. The shell has a rigid portion supporting the fastening means and a controlled deformation portion positioned between the rigid portion and the padding. The controlled deformation portion has at least one yielding insert adapted to deform elastically under compression during use.

Seating apparatus
10967928 · 2021-04-06 ·

A seating apparatus may include a seating unit and a pair of hollow supporting structure. In one embodiment, the hollow supporting structure is bowl-shaped springs which can be disposed underneath a seating unit to receive and support the buttocks of the user. In another embodiment, the seating unit can include a regular seat, a stool, a bicycle seat, and even a horse saddle. More specifically, the buttocks of the user can be received in a concave surface of each bowl-shaped spring so a complete support over a large area is provided to the user's buttocks and pubic bone to eliminate the pressure therefrom. Furthermore, the springs can also be used as cushions to absorb impact on the user's lower body portion. In another aspect, the hollow supporting structure is a pair of rings, and in a further aspect, the hollow supporting structure is a pair of bowl-shaped units.
